New Steroid Law (DASCA) Goes Into Effect

On December 18, 2014, President Obama signed the Designer Anabolic Steroid Control Act of 2014 – DASCA for short. Several years in the making, DASCA cracks down on the over-the-counter “prohormone” segment of the sports nutrition supplement market. 25 New “Anabolic Steroids.” DASCA lists 25 steroidal compounds as newly criminalized anabolic steroids. What’s in Your Protein? Nitrogen Spiking in the Sports Nutrition Industry

On July 1, 2014, a consumer class action complaint was filed in the Federal District Court for the Central District of California against a dietary supplement company alleging that two of their whey protein products were misleading consumers as to protein content.  Protein content is indirectly determined by testing the nitrogen content of the product. …

Industry Stakeholders Question FDA’s Cost Estimate for NDI Notifications

The dietary supplement industry continues to wait for FDA to publish a revised guidance on New Dietary Ingredients (NDI) and NDI notifications (NDINs).  But recently, the Agency estimated that preparing an NDIN should take only twenty hours and incur no capital costs.  FDA explained that its estimate isolates the time and expense of researching the safety…
